Transaction abaded9528bafbc3aa97c777f5e00b03234a634b2cb73d76fd81388765c9fe7e
1 Input
1 Output
-
abaded9528bafbc3aa97c777f5e00b03234a634b2cb73d76fd81388765c9fe7e:0
- value
- 818340
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dadab7f5334ff6654954de1ca587776e823f6e3a OP_EQUAL
- address
- 3MeDFCMHz35drkSTRK21bAYArfqTiKE9eD